Profile
Worldcolor Mt. Morris is a 4-color plant with both rotogravure and web offset capabilities. The plant’s focus is catalogs (offset and gravure) and gravure press delivered products (retail inserts and Sunday magazines).

Manifest Information
Manifests should be sent electronically to Sterling Commerce Network, mailbox: ZZ WPC CDC RLI. A copy of each manifest must be faxed to Paper Purchasing and a copy must be included in the vehicle with the shipments.
Rail Delivery
Worldcolor Mt. Morris is on a direct siding of the Burlington Northern SanteFe. The BNSF has contracted with Illinois Railway to provide switch service from Oregon, IL to Mt. Morris. Ship no more than 2 railcars per day, per purchase order. Railcars are only made available Monday thru Friday by Illinois Railway in Oregon, IL. Plan accordingly.
Truck Delivery
Ship no more than 2 trucks per day, per order, maximum 4 per site (mill/plant/warehouse). All trucks must make a delivery appointment a minimum of 24 hours in advance. Non-adherance to these shipping instructions and delivery requirements will result in storage or demurrage charge-backs.

Exceptions
Additional Specifications
Relative to the Worldcolor Requirements and Specifications paragraph 3.2, the Mt. Morris Division will reject an individual roll if 3 unknown paper caused web breaks to occur. Worldcolor shall be compensated according to the provisions of the Roll Paper Requirements and Specifications.
A 3" core should have an inside diameter not less than 3.010" or greater than 3.025".
